Games2Rule - Mad Escape is another type of point and click new escape game developed by Games 2 Rule. This is the real escaping challenge game for you because you are trapped in an isolated forest and its night, you want to escape immediate but you don’t know the way of escape. You have to make way for escape one by one. You have to search the way of escape in every step. It’s a too much of suspense thriller game. Only Sharp minded people can escape from here. If you can escape from here then just play and show your escaping skill and mind sharpness.  Good luck and have fun!
